1-Bromobutane is offered in laboratory-suitable formats for research and production. It has a molecular formula of C4H9Br and a molecular weight of 137.02. This compound exhibits a Boiling Point of 101.1 °C, as well as a Melting Point of -112.2 °C. The hazard signal word for this substance is Danger due to its high flammability and potential carcinogenic effects.
- CAS Number: 109-65-9
- Exact Mass: 135.98876
- Molecular Formula: C4H9Br
- Boiling Point: 101.1 °C
- Molecular Weight: 137.02
- Melting Point: -112.2 °C
- GHS Signal Word: Danger
- Vapour Density: 4.72
- Hazard Statements:
- H225: Highly Flammable liquid and vapor [Danger Flammable liquids]
- H350: May cause cancer [Danger Carcinogenicity]
